When creating a subnet in the context of Google Cloud Platform's Cloud VPC, specifying a region serves a crucial purpose. The region parameter allows users to define the geographic location where the subnet will be provisioned. This decision has significant implications for network performance, data redundancy, and compliance requirements.
One key reason for specifying a region is to optimize network performance. By selecting a region close to the target users or services, network latency can be minimized. This is particularly important for applications that require low latency, such as real-time communication or financial transactions. For example, if a company's target audience is located in Europe, creating a subnet in the Europe region would ensure that the network traffic between users and the application remains fast and responsive.
Another important aspect is data redundancy and availability. By creating subnets in multiple regions, users can distribute their resources and data across different geographic locations. This helps to ensure high availability and fault tolerance in case of regional outages or disasters. For instance, if a company's primary data center is located in the US, they can create a secondary subnet in the Europe region. In the event of a localized failure, the secondary subnet can seamlessly handle the traffic and maintain service continuity.
Moreover, specifying a region is crucial for compliance and data sovereignty requirements. Different regions have varying legal and regulatory frameworks that govern data protection and privacy. By creating subnets in specific regions, organizations can ensure that their data remains within the jurisdictional boundaries required by law. For instance, the European Union's General Data Protection Regulation (GDPR) mandates that personal data of EU citizens must be stored and processed within the EU. By creating a subnet in a European region, organizations can comply with such regulations.
Additionally, specifying a region allows users to take advantage of region-specific services and features. Google Cloud Platform offers a range of services that are available only in specific regions. For example, certain machine types or storage options may be available only in select regions. By creating a subnet in a particular region, users can leverage these region-specific services and optimize their infrastructure accordingly.
Specifying a region when creating a subnet in Google Cloud Platform's Cloud VPC is essential for optimizing network performance, ensuring data redundancy and availability, complying with legal and regulatory requirements, and taking advantage of region-specific services. It allows users to strategically position their resources and tailor their infrastructure to meet their specific needs.
Other recent questions and answers regarding Cloud VPC:
- What are the IP address ranges for the three subnets created in this tutorial?
- How do you create a subnet within a custom network?
- What is the difference between a custom network and an automatic VPC network?
- What are the steps to create a custom network and an automatic VPC network using Google Cloud Platform?